Patent
Gas phase alkylation-liquid phase transalkylation process
TL;DR: In this paper, a feedstock containing benzene and ethylene is applied to a multi-stage alkylation reaction zone having a plurality of series-connected catalyst beds containing a pentasil molecular sieve alkyl catalyst which is silicalite of a predominantly monoclinic symmetry having a silica/alumina ratio of at least 275.

Patent
Gas phase alkylation with split load of catalyst
TL;DR: In this article, a feedstock containing benzene and ethylene is applied to a multi-stage alkylation reaction zone having a plurality of series-connected catalyst beds, at least one of which contains a first monoclinic silicalite catalyst having a silica/alumina ratio of at least 275.
Patent
Gas phase alkylation method and catalyst
TL;DR: In this article, a feedstock containing benzene and ethylene is applied to an alkylation reaction zone having at least one catalyst bed containing a monoclinic silicalite catalyst having a weak acid site concentration of less than 50 micromoles per gram.
